’Fleta?’ It was a unique name to be sure, but then again, the dark wolfess had never met another ‘Blind’ before. With a nod of recognition, she chuckled and flicked her tail happily. Pleasure to meet you Miss Fleta. I’m Blind, she said. Finally stepping off the canine, the dark wolf took her place beside Fleta again and stretched out on her belly, resting her snout on her paws. She hadn’t realized how tired she was until now, as she laid beneath the afternoon sun. It was most likely a result of her running around after neglecting to eat, however, and that could be remedied easily enough.

Lifting her head once again, Blind surveyed the area as the coywolf had done moments ago, although SHE was looking for prey. A velvety tongue traced the line of her dark lips as she imagined what might be hiding in the underbrush, and soon enough bi-colored eyes turned back on the hybrid beside her. I’m starving, Blind finally admitted, her tail swishing eagerly, care to join me for a hunt? Rising to her feet, the she-wolf gave her fur a quick shake, followed by a good stretch of her lithe body. She could feel the anticipation bubbling up inside her, and the hunger even more-so. Whereas before she might have thought it a curse to go hunting with the canine who had stolen her lunch, now she considered it a blessing as she realized she had the opportunity to learn a thing or two and perhaps catch something more than a rabbit. Although she knew her hip would make things difficult, she’d have to learn to completely push through it sooner or later, or she’d not last much longer in the harsh wilderness. Without a pack, things would be much harder for the she-wolf; she’d barely gotten by BEFORE joining Crimson Dreams. Now it was just a matter of time before the shortage of food left her in dire circumstances.

A huge grin broke out on Terra's face at hearing the wolf's name. Somebody obviously had a sense of humor when naming her. The wolf was indeed blind to the dangers around her, so open and playful. Even as a pup somebody had noticed her naive friendly nature, granting her such a name to live up to. Blind settled in beside Terra, obviously exhausted from all the playing around. She chuckled lightly as the chocolate wolf snuggled into her. Blind wasn't as ready to just relax as Terra was though. Her head came back up, scanning the area.


Terra met Blind's gaze steadily at the words. She wasn't in the mood for hunting. Terra just wanted to laze around, maybe head back to her pack and rest up. Blind clambered to her feet, tail swishing eagerly. Yawning Terra stretched. Shaking herself out Terra let out a happy yap. I don't believe I'll be joining you. You did turn down my offer earlier, after all. Mockingly her tail wagged behind her. Maybe Blind could convince her, but this was a lesson as well. You ate when you could, and didn't turn down such generous offers. They wouldn't necessarily be there later.

Blind watched the hybrid as she stood and stretched herself out, her ears finally flattening at the rejecting jeer she offered as a response. She chuckled softly, lowering her head a bit as she looked at Fleta sheepishly. Ah, I suppose I did do that, she said, finally looking away again. She assumed this was their good-bye then, for Blind was far too hungry to attempt to stick around and ignore her hunger in order to play. Their time together would be valued by Blind, however, for it was that kind of happy interruption to her loneliness that chased away any bit of ensuing madness.

Stepping over to the coywolf, Blind stole a quick lick to a pointed ear before turning again, an innocent smile crossing her lips with finality. As her hunger increased, her desire to play waned; she wouldn’t leave this coywolf with as teasing of a salutation as she would have liked to. With a polite bow of her head, Blind giggled softly before the muscles in her legs tensed, ready to run off into the forest. It was a pleasure to meet you Fleta, she admitted, holding the hybrid’s gaze. I hope one day we’ll cross paths again. Then, with a flick of her chocolate tail, she bounded off into the darkness without another word, praying it wasn’t too late to find dinner.
